Headcount Plan FY-Next — Restricted: Managers Only

Vandelhorn Logistics will add 42 roles next year, concentrated in the Ostergate and Pellwick branches. Warehouse operations receive 24 positions, customer service 10, and fleet maintenance 8. No reductions are planned, though backfills require regional approval. Hiring opens in the first quarter; budget codes will be issued separately. Branch managers should submit role justifications before month-end. The confidential note on business plans appears below.

management briefing: Project Ulavan slips by two quarters because of the staffing delay.

Subject: Flag rollout framework — on-call basics

Hi,

Welcome aboard. You'll be covering Lampwick, our feature-flag rollout framework. Flags propagate from the Orrery control plane to edge caches within about 30 seconds; if a rollout stalls, check the propagation dashboard first. Kill switches are instant and safe to use — prefer them over manual edits. Pager escalations go to the Lampwick rotation, not platform. Everything else you need, including runbooks and rollback steps, is on the internal page below.

operations page: https://vault.qorvelcorp.example/settings

## Step 4: Health Checks Behind the Balancer

Before shifting traffic to the new Lanternfish pool, confirm the balancer probes the `/livez` endpoint rather than the legacy root path. A misconfigured probe will mark healthy nodes as down and stall the cutover, so verify the interval and failure threshold match what the Quayside team validated in staging. Do not proceed to Step 5 until all three zones report green. The probe settings currently in effect are listed below.

deployment values, kajep-kageg:
[praix]
host = praix.paliqcorp.corp
user = praix_svc
database = praix_prod

Hey — before you can review my branch, heads up: the Brimworth secrets vault that holds the QueueLift scaling tokens locked itself again after the cert rotation. The autoscaler reads queue-depth metrics from Pondermill, and without the vault open, the integration tests just hang, so don't blame your review env. I already pinged the platform folks; they said any reviewer can unseal it themselves. Pop open the vault CLI, pick the QueueLift realm, and paste in the recovery passphrase below.

vault phrase of tagaf-hawef = jordor-wenok-gorael-wenion-keleth-sorion-wenys-novix-fenir-fraax-fenael-aldius-fraok